If the marriage is through a US Citizen, do remember that you can also file the I-485 adjustment of status with your spouse's I-130 form.
In answer to your question -- the I-130 specifically askes, so yes, your spouse should put the information on his form. Also, YOU have to sign a G-325A to be submitted with your spouse's I-130 and you will have to disclose it there.
